When decorating your home, you're likely focusing on color schemes. And while color is an essential part of interior design, materials matter too. Properly combining different materials adds depth, texture, and interest to your space. One trendy example in modern homes is utilizing brass accents to update your decor. Here are a few ways to tie this gorgeous, visually interesting material into your home.

Switch Plates

When it comes to metallic accents, a little can go a long way. They're so visually captivating that too much brass (or other metal) in a room can really overwhelm the space. So, if you're adding brass accents, start small. Decorative switch plates are a great place to start. You might not pay much attention to these functional pieces in your home, but when you dress them up with a bit of brass and a touch of class, those little pieces become gorgeous decorative accents.

Lighting Fixtures

Another great way to tie brass into any room is with the lighting fixtures. Again, these don't take up a lot of physical space, but going from dull white to eye-catching brass can really turn your lighting fixtures into focal points of the room. You can do this in any room in your home too.

Add a brass desk lamp in your office, a brass floor lamp in your living room, and brass pendant lights over the bar in your kitchen. Even a single lighting fixture in brass can help to tie your room together and give it a whole new look.

Brass Hardware

Another great way to incorporate brass elements into your home decor is with the hardware on your cupboards and drawers. Obviously, this is going to have the biggest impact in your kitchen or in a bathroom, as there's going to be a lot more hardware to switch out. But if you really want to tie this material into another space, don't be afraid to switch out the hardware on your nightstands, end tables, coffee tables, entertainment centers, office desks, and other pieces of furniture.

Just be sure to get the right measurements for any hardware that you're planning to switch out. It may even be a good idea to bring a piece of your current cabinetry hardware to the store with you, to ensure you purchase replacements of the right size.

Small Decorative Pieces

One final option for adding brass accents to a room is to just add a few decorative pieces made of the material. Because of brass's current popularity in home decor, it's not difficult to find a wide variety of decorative items to choose from for your space. From brass picture frames to small brass sculptures to large pieces of brass wall art, there's a lot of options available to you. Find something that works well with your space.

If you want to update your home decor with brass accents for a modern, industrial look, be sure to start small so that you don't overdo it. Start with some brass decorative wall switch platesThen, start incorporating the other ideas mentioned in this article until you strike the right balance by adding visual interest to your room without it feeling overly industrialized.
